8,253 bones analysed using ZooMS at Denisova Cave!!! This has been the focus of our research for nearly 6 years and I’m so excited to finally share it! Katerina Douka Tom Higham Naihui_Wang Annette Oertle Mike Buckley Siberian Archaeology #Archaeology #ZooMS nature.com/articles/s4159…

We identified 5 new hominin remains at Denisova Cave! Included are three ~200,000 year old Denisovans, the earliest known fossils for this population so far @Katerina_Douka Tom Higham Siberian Archaeology Massilani Lab Janet Kelso NatureEcoEvo @MPI_SHH nature.com/articles/s4155…

A new #openaccess study in Proceedings B presents the largest application of #ZooMS in East Asia to date. Researchers analyzed ~900 bone fragments from Palaeolithic caves in northern and southern China, discovering previously unidentified camel remains buff.ly/3FwtIa8

Really happy this next paper from my PhD is out now! We used FTIR, ZooMS and deamidation rates to assess the preservation of collagen in the Australian archaeological and paleontological record. nature.com/articles/s4324…
